CONCLUSION: Cryoablation for symptomatic DF is aAbstract : AIM: To report the first UK experience of cryoablation in desmoid fibromatosis (DF) with particular focus on technique, safety, and efficacy. MATERIALS AND METHODS: Patients were selected at multidisciplinary tumour board meetings at a specialist cancer hospital. Radiation dose, procedure duration, and number of cryoprobes were compared for small versus large tumours (>10 cm long axis). Response at magnetic resonance imaging (MRI) was evaluated using different criteria, and percentage agreement with clinical response as assessed in oncology clinic calculated. RESULTS: Thirteen procedures were performed in 10 patients (eight women, median age 51 years, IQR 42–69 years) between February 2019 and August 2021. Procedures for large tumours had higher radiation dose (2, 012 ± 1, 012 versus 1, 076 ± 519 mGy·cm, p= 0.048) used more cryoprobes (13 ± 7 versus 4 ± 2, p= 0.009), and were more likely to have residual unablated tumour (38 ± 37% versus 7.5 ± 10%, p= 0.045). Adverse events were minor apart from one transient radial nerve palsy. Eight of 10 patients had symptomatic benefit at clinical follow-up (median 353 days, IQR 86–796 days), and three started systemic therapy mean 393 days later. All patients who had complete ablation demonstrated symptomatic response, with no instances of repeat treatment, recurrence, or need for systemic therapy during the study period. All progression occurred outside ablation zones. CONCLUSION: Cryoablation for symptomatic DF is a reproducible technique with low, transient toxicity, where one or two treatments can achieve a meaningful response. Where possible, the ablation ice ball should fully cover DF tumours. Highlights: Cryoablation for desmoid fibromatosis has been reproduced at a UK centre. Our results show few adverse events and high levels of symptomatic benefit. Tumour volume seems to better reflect symptomatic response than long-axis measurement. … (more)
